"The Team Trainer" by William I. Gorden is a comprehensive guide that aims to help team leaders and trainers improve the performance and cooperation within their teams. Drawing from his extensive experience in corporate training and team building, Gorden provides practical strategies and techniques that can be implemented in various professional settings.

One of the key focuses of the book is effective team communication and interpersonal relationships. Gorden emphasizes the importance of establishing trust and open channels of communication within a team, and he explores different communication styles to help readers foster a positive team culture. By creating a supportive environment, Gorden believes that teams can overcome obstacles and achieve their goals.

Problem-solving skills are also a crucial aspect of team building, and Gorden delves into various problem-solving techniques in the book. He encourages team leaders to create a collaborative environment where team members feel empowered to share their ideas and solutions. Gorden emphasizes the importance of techniques such as brainstorming, active listening, and providing constructive criticism to encourage innovation and effective problem-solving.

Leadership plays a significant role in team dynamics, and Gorden offers insights on how leaders can motivate their team members and create a sense of purpose and shared vision. He explores the qualities of effective leaders and provides practical advice on leading by example, setting clear goals, and offering constructive feedback.

The book also provides guidance on how to navigate conflicts within a team. Gorden offers methods for identifying and addressing conflicts promptly and constructively. By providing practical tips on conflict resolution, the book aims to help team leaders foster a harmonious and productive team environment.

The book "The Team Trainer" by William I. Gorden has received a mixture of opinions from readers. Some reviewers have praised the book for its practical insights and helpful advice on team building and training, while others have criticized it for being outdated and lacking in depth.

Many readers appreciated the practical approach to team building presented in "The Team Trainer." They found the author's emphasis on teamwork and communication to be applicable to various settings, both professional and personal. Reviewers found the examples and exercises provided in the book to be valuable tools for improving teamwork and creating a positive work environment.

However, there were some readers who felt that "The Team Trainer" lacked depth and failed to provide innovative approaches to team training. They found the information to be basic and repetitive, and expressed disappointment at the absence of groundbreaking concepts or fresh ideas in the book.

Another common critique of "The Team Trainer" was its lack of engagement and readability. Some reviewers found the book to be dry and poorly organized, making it difficult to stay motivated and engaged while reading. They expressed a desire for a more accessible and engaging writing style from the author.

Furthermore, there were readers who felt that "The Team Trainer" did not offer sufficient real-life examples or case studies to support the author's arguments. They struggled to relate to the theoretical concepts presented and wished for more practical examples of successful team training initiatives.
